Loverock Road is in Reading and in Reading district. RG30 1DZ is located in the Battle elect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Reading West. This postcode has been in use since 1995-07-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around RG30 1DZ,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 53.4%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(91.3%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Loverock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Loverock Road was 215.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 43.7% lower than the Abbey average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Loverock Road has the 25th highest crime rate of 100 local areas in Abbey and the 48th highest crime rate of 488 local areas in Reading .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 62.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 107.4%.
